Output 9b0604a595ac21c9e974cdac3c7a87cd76a30b267cf954171adf500224986295:9

value
2680391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037756cc98a576e2ea481ebab7e026e49cba670d OP_EQUAL
address
321LuwcgL4RkQVXSp2CMBMwWVH8rwfdvpN
transaction
9b0604a595ac21c9e974cdac3c7a87cd76a30b267cf954171adf500224986295
spent
true